About this subject

5G technology represents the fifth generation of mobile networks, offering download speeds up to 20 Gbps and latency below 1 millisecond. This evolution enables advances in areas such as the Internet of Things (IoT), autonomous vehicles, and telemedicine. In Brazil, 5G implementation officially began in July 2022, following the frequency band auction by Anatel in 2021. The 3.5 GHz band, ideal for balancing coverage and capacity, was the main one allocated for standalone 5G. Major urban centers like São Paulo, Rio de Janeiro, and Brasília were the first to receive the technology, with plans to expand to all state capitals by 2029. Frequently Asked Questions

What differentiates 5G from 4G in terms of speed?

5G offers theoretical download speeds of up to 20 Gbps, while 4G reaches a maximum of 1 Gbps. In practice, 5G can be 10 to 100 times faster than 4G, depending on implementation.

How many 5G antennas are there in Brazil?

As of 2023, Brazil had over 10,000 licensed 5G antennas, mainly concentrated in capital cities. The goal is to reach 50,000 antennas by 2025, according to the Brazilian Association of Telecommunications Infrastructure (Abrint).

Does 5G work in rural areas?

Yes, but with limitations. Higher frequencies (e.g., 26 GHz) have short range, ideal for dense areas. For rural zones, 5G can use lower bands (e.g., 700 MHz) for wider coverage, though with reduced speeds.
